How Much Does a Location Plan Cost? UK Price Guide

A location plan is one of the lower-cost parts of a planning application, but prices are not identical because a small house plot and a large rural site require different mapping coverage.

What affects the price?

The main factors are the area covered, chosen scale, output format and paper size. A standard A4 PDF generally costs less than a large-area plan, printed set or CAD extract. Check the current price list before ordering.

  • Scale and ground coverage
  • A4, A3 or bespoke paper size
  • PDF, image, Word, DWG or DXF format
  • Printed copies or digital download
  • Standard or manually prepared plan

Why a free or very cheap map may not be comparable

Check whether the price includes licensed current mapping, a true print scale, a north arrow, boundary tools and a usable download. A screenshot is not the same product as a planning-use map.

How to avoid buying twice

Check the council list first, decide whether you also need a block plan and make sure the red boundary is correct before checkout. Previewing the mapping helps catch location errors.

Compare like with like

A low headline price may cover only a small standard PDF, while another quote may include wider mapping, a larger sheet, CAD data, printed copies or boundary preparation. Before comparing prices, write down the scale, ground coverage, page size, file format and delivery method needed for the same site.

Items to compare in a location-plan quote
ItemQuestion to ask
MappingIs it current and licensed for the intended planning submission?
CoverageDoes it include the full site, access and enough identifying context?
OutputIs the price for PDF, editable data, print or a bundle?
PreparationAre boundaries self-drawn or checked and prepared for you?
RevisionsWhat happens if the authority asks for a corrected boundary?

The map charge is not the planning application fee

A location plan is a supporting document purchased or prepared separately. The planning application fee, designer's work, surveys, specialist reports, printing and professional advice are different costs. Keep them as separate lines in the project budget so a cheap map is not mistaken for the total cost of submitting an application.

The cheapest plan is poor value if it cannot be validated

Before paying, check that the output can meet the receiving authority's scale, north-point, context, boundary and licensing requirements. A general web-map screenshot, unlicensed extract or rescaled PDF can lead to a replacement purchase and delay even if it was free or inexpensive.

Questions people also ask

Is there an official fixed price for a location plan?

No. Planning rules describe what an acceptable plan should show; commercial suppliers set their own prices for mapping and preparation.

Why can a rural location plan cost more?

A rural site may require wider coverage, a larger sheet, more licensed mapping or manual work to show a long access and dispersed land clearly. That is a supplier decision, not a statutory rule.

Does the location-plan price include the application fee?

Normally not. The map and the planning application fee are separate, and design or specialist reports may also be charged separately.

What should I check before choosing the lowest quote?

Confirm scale, sheet size, coverage, licensing, boundary tools, file format, delivery and revision arrangements for the same specification.
